Let's explore some key technological advancements that contribute to the superior performance of Nike football boots:
1. Flyknit Technology: Flyknit, a revolutionary construction technique, creates a lightweight, breathable, and supportive upper. By precisely placing yarns where they're needed most, Flyknit provides a snug, sock-like fit that enhances ball control and reduces the risk of blisters and discomfort. Many purple Nike football boots incorporate Flyknit technology, offering players a superior level of comfort and performance.
2. NikeGrip: The NikeGrip technology, often found in indoor football shoes (zaalvoetbalschoenen), focuses on superior traction and grip on indoor surfaces. This technology minimizes the risk of slipping and twisting, reducing the likelihood of ankle injuries and enhancing agility. While primarily featured in indoor shoes, the principles of enhanced grip and stability are applied across Nike's football boot range, ensuring optimal performance on various surfaces. The connection between the exceptional grip of NikeGrip and the overall performance benefits across their range is significant.
3. React Foam: For those seeking maximum cushioning and responsiveness, Nike's React foam midsole provides exceptional comfort and energy return. This innovative foam technology absorbs impact effectively, reducing stress on joints and enhancing responsiveness during explosive movements. While not always a primary feature in all football boots, its inclusion in certain models contributes to overall comfort and performance.
4. ACC (All Conditions Control): This technology ensures consistent ball control in wet or dry conditions. By creating a textured surface on the upper, ACC helps to maintain grip on the ball regardless of the weather, improving a player's ability to control and manipulate the ball with precision. This is a crucial feature for players who need reliable performance in various weather conditions.
